Why Eberechi Eze Turned Down Super Eagles – Amaju Pinnick.

Pinnick, who led the NFF from October 2014 to October 2022, oversaw a period when several foreign-born players switched allegiance to Nigeria, including Alex Iwobi, Ola Aina, Ademola Lookman, and Calvin Bassey. However, the country also lost top talents like Jamal Musiala, Karim Adeyemi, Tammy Abraham, and Eze.
Eze’s connection to Nigeria dates back to March 2017, when the then 18-year-old Queens Park Rangers midfielder was pictured in a Super Eagles jersey during a London training camp. He had been invited by former head coach Gernot Rohr for planned friendlies against Senegal and Burkina Faso, matches later canceled due to security concerns.
Pinnick explained that all arrangements for Eze’s switch were nearly complete before the player and his representatives decided to postpone.
“Eberechi Eze came, I met his dad, and we had a long discussion—he agreed to play for Nigeria,” Pinnick said on the Playzone and Dangolo Way show.
“His sister, who was his manager at the time, came to my flat, and all the documentation was ready. But they asked us to hold on. Maybe the NFF elections came, and I left—that’s probably why he didn’t play.
“Eberechi loved Nigeria, I can tell you that. I went through my messages with him at some point.”
Pinnick also reflected on the challenges of convincing Ademola Lookman to commit after initially rejecting Nigeria twice, recalling how he eventually connected with Lookman’s father and successfully completed the paperwork.
Ultimately, Eze chose to represent England, making his senior debut in 2023. Since then, he has earned 16 caps, starting in four matches.
